The Rising Popularity of Rogen’s Apocalyptic Comedy
This Is the End, a 2013 apocalyptic comedy directed by Seth Rogen and Evan Goldberg, has climbed into the top ten most-streamed movies on Starz in the United States. This film, which marked the directorial debut for the pair, earned strong praise upon release, holding an 82% critics’ score on Rotten Tomatoes. Much of its acclaim focuses on the ensemble cast featuring regular collaborators like Jonah Hill, Michael Cera, Christopher Mintz, Danny McBride, and Craig Robinson.
The movie also features notable appearances by Jason Segel, Kevin Hart, Rihanna, and Emma Watson, adding to its broad appeal. In a chaotic Hollywood setting, actor James Franco hosts a party attended by a group of friends when a sudden apocalypse of biblical scale burns through the city, trapping the guests inside Franco’s home. As conditions deteriorate, the friends face extreme challenges related to isolation and scarce resources.

Other Streaming Hits on Starz
Though This Is the End stands at a notable tenth place in Starz’s streaming rankings, other films are drawing more viewers. Titles such as Daniel Radcliffe’s thriller Imperium and the World War II action feature The Ministry of Ungentlemanly Warfare command higher positions on the platform’s chart. Nonetheless, none have displaced the unexpected 2025 box office disappointment, From the World of John Wick: Ballerina, which remains a dominant presence at the top.
